Transparency
We believe a civic platform should be completely open about how it operates and what it costs. Here's everything that keeps Convoca running — no surprises, no fine print.
Total monthly cost
~€5/month
Infrastructure and tools
| Service | What it does | Monthly cost |
|---|---|---|
| Vercel | Hosting and deployment of the web application | €0 (free tier) |
| Convex | Real-time database and backend functions | €0 (free tier) |
| Resend | Transactional email — confirmations, reminders, and magic links | €0 (free tier) |
| OpenRouter | AI models for parsing event emails and posters | ~€3/month (variable usage) |
| Claude Code | Development tooling and code assistance | ~€2/month (variable usage) |
| Clerk | Authentication for the admin area | €0 (free tier) |
| Sentry | Error monitoring and crash reporting | €0 (free tier) |
| convoca.pt | Domain name registration | ~€0.50/month (billed annually) |
Funding
Convoca is self-funded by its creator. There are no investors, sponsors, ads, or external funding of any kind. One person builds and maintains this platform in their spare time, because they believe local events deserve better infrastructure.
